The Dilemma of Gold Companies

Thank you for your introduction and the opportunity to
speak at such an important forum. I feel honoured to be the Tas McKee speaker
for this year's conference. I can honestly say that Tas McKee typified the
spirit that has ensured the survival of the mining industry despite the
modern-day challenges that we encounter. He was one of the most influential
people in the New Zealand
minerals industry. In 1938, with his father and brother, Tas established Lime
& Marble Limited. Over its history, this company evolved from its original
base of marble mining to diversify into gold mining and exploration for other
industrial minerals, uranium, precious and base metals. He was truly a pioneer
that persevered against the odds.

That leads me to the subject of my discussion today. I am
going to delve into today's challenges as they apply to gold companies. While we
gold miners should be generating record returns, the gold industry shareholder
return performance in this buoyant market has barely equalled that of the gold
price. It is a dilemma but one that can be resolved with the right
strategy.
